Output 828b10464ac576ec2cc81290bcdfc43aef274dd053e0e3c5fd328b5e332ffcb7:43

value
5154579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e508b44f2dff05790c0ad5efa948c7509924768 OP_EQUAL
address
MHxT3pzMWDBfCdXQay2D1CZAPZqKQHBYRE
transaction
828b10464ac576ec2cc81290bcdfc43aef274dd053e0e3c5fd328b5e332ffcb7
spent
true